I am Dr. Elishia Oliva, MD. Thanks for taking a moment to read a little bit about me. I am a Board Certified Adult Psychiatrist and Medical Doctor as well as a Colorado Native who has been in practice since the completion of my medical school training, internship, and psychiatry residency at the University of Colorado School of Medicine. In addition to being a physician and psychiatrist, I also hold a Bachelor of Science in Psychology. I specialize in psychiatric diagnosis and medication management for adults. Throughout my career in psychiatry, I have received prior recognitions as a Colorado Permanente Medical Group Top 100 Physician as well as being a 5280 Top Doc in Psychiatry. I treat all ages 18 years and older and am comfortable treating, assessing, and diagnosing a full range of various mental health conditions. These include, but are not limited to: depression, anxiety disorders, trauma disorders, personality disorders, mood disorders, attention concerns, eating disorders, and assessment of sleep concerns. However, please note that as of January 1, 2025, I will only be taking ADHD patients with an existing diagnosis and already on medications. For any new ADHD diagnosis requests with medication management, I will be requiring formal neuropsychiatric testing demonstrating an adult ADHD diagnosis and at that point, once confirmed through neuropsychiatric testing, I am happy to mange medications for ADHD. You can usually check with your insurance company for your testing options. This new protocol will not affect any of my existing patients. If it is determined that I am unable to meet your treatment needs, I will work with you to find resources that can. I believe in practicing safe and evidence-based medicine and will work with you in a collaborative manner to determine the best treatment course for you. You are truly the expert in your experiences, history, and symptoms.
